🛡️

Secure Resharding

Resharding: randomized validator assignment to prevent single-shard attacks

We are re-assigning shard membership of validators every epoch to enhance our network security. Our innovations include using verifiable delay function (VDF) for randomized assignment, integrating staking and slashing with resharding, and forcing regular leader rotations. Harmony will be among the first blockchains to launch resharding.

Cryptology ePrint Archive: Report 2018/460 - RapidChain: Scaling Blockchain via Full Sharding

RapidChain: Scaling Blockchain via Full Sharding Mahdi Zamani and Mahnush Movahedi and Mariana Raykova Abstract: A major approach to overcoming the performance and scalability limitations of current blockchain protocols is to use sharding, which is to split the overheads of processing transactions among multiple, smaller groups of nodes.